Ripple Clown Goby
Gobiodon rivulatus
This tiny clown goby features wavy facial lines and relies on branching Acropora for shelter. Ideal for nano tanks, it must be fed micro-carnivore foods daily.

- They are profoundly peaceful and mostly remain entirely motionless while observing their surroundings. They only show brief bursts of energy to grab food or chase away rivals. Their quirky, sedentary nature makes them a favorite among dedicated reefkeepers.

- As a micro-carnivore, it requires tiny, meaty morsels to survive. Nutritious foods like cyclops, rotifers, and very finely crushed flakes are ideal. They will also naturally hunt for microscopic copepods living within the coral branches.

- They are best kept as a single individual or as a mated pair. Like other coral gobies, they possess bidirectional sex change capabilities to form pairs. Avoid keeping multiple unpaired individuals in anything less than a massive tank.

- Feed them one to two times daily using a targeted approach. Turning off the water flow during feeding helps them catch their tiny food. A turkey baster gently squeezing food near their perch works absolute wonders.

- Captive spawning is occasionally documented when a true pair is comfortably established. They clear a tiny patch on a coral branch to lay their adhesive eggs. Unfortunately, successfully rearing the incredibly small fry is exceptionally difficult.
